TalentSky, Inc.
Overview
Consolidated front-end engineering achievements at Talentsky from 2020 to 2024, focusing on architecture, SSR, tooling upgrades, and workshop features. Key Contributions
June 2024 – August 2024:
Created architecture and assisted in server-side rendering. Used Vite to render both server and client with a minimal package footprint to speed up initial load times and improve performance for users and bots. April 2020 – April 2024:
Created, maintained and extended the basic architecture and implementation of server-side rendering (SSR) used on Talentsky. Vite supported the development environment for fast development and on-demand SSR. Server-side state is managed with Redux. A common static method is used to cross over between Node and client for backend calls on page-level components, and a global initial state is generated to repopulate with React. January 2024 – April 2024:
Led the frontend integration of Zoom's SDK into Talentsky's software infrastructure, ensuring a robust architecture for real-time video communications; collaborated with cross-functional teams to design and implement a secure, scalable system. October 2023 – December 2023:
Developed software for Talentsky workshops; contributed to building a new workshop feature for Talentsky.com. Chakra UI adoption:
Chakra UI is a component library used to normalize styling of React layouts; based on TypeScript definitions, it speeds up the creation of responsive layouts and is used in workshop pages. January 2023 – April 2023:
Built out the new messaging system for Talentsky; created components and connectivity with XD designs, using the getStream SDK to build the chat module and main messaging page with external linking via email. October 2022 – January 2023:
Upgraded frontend build tools from Webpack to Vite, enabling SSR and dynamic imports, with improvements to routing and loading; the site builds are significantly faster and development is streamlined. October 2022 – January 2023:
Upgraded frontend code from React 15.6 to React 18.2 to enhance security and integration with third-party libraries; this required a routing rewrite to fit the new structure and enabled modern features to speed up loading. September 2021 – October 2021:
Consulted with engineering staff to evaluate interface between hardware and software, develop specifications and performance requirements, or resolve customer problems. Technologies & Roles
Tech stack: TypeScript, React.JS, Redux, WebSocket, getStream.io, Adobe XD, Chakra UI Roles: Front End Engineering; Quality Assurance Software at Talentsky
#J-18808-Ljbffr
Consolidated front-end engineering achievements at Talentsky from 2020 to 2024, focusing on architecture, SSR, tooling upgrades, and workshop features. Key Contributions
June 2024 – August 2024:
Created architecture and assisted in server-side rendering. Used Vite to render both server and client with a minimal package footprint to speed up initial load times and improve performance for users and bots. April 2020 – April 2024:
Created, maintained and extended the basic architecture and implementation of server-side rendering (SSR) used on Talentsky. Vite supported the development environment for fast development and on-demand SSR. Server-side state is managed with Redux. A common static method is used to cross over between Node and client for backend calls on page-level components, and a global initial state is generated to repopulate with React. January 2024 – April 2024:
Led the frontend integration of Zoom's SDK into Talentsky's software infrastructure, ensuring a robust architecture for real-time video communications; collaborated with cross-functional teams to design and implement a secure, scalable system. October 2023 – December 2023:
Developed software for Talentsky workshops; contributed to building a new workshop feature for Talentsky.com. Chakra UI adoption:
Chakra UI is a component library used to normalize styling of React layouts; based on TypeScript definitions, it speeds up the creation of responsive layouts and is used in workshop pages. January 2023 – April 2023:
Built out the new messaging system for Talentsky; created components and connectivity with XD designs, using the getStream SDK to build the chat module and main messaging page with external linking via email. October 2022 – January 2023:
Upgraded frontend build tools from Webpack to Vite, enabling SSR and dynamic imports, with improvements to routing and loading; the site builds are significantly faster and development is streamlined. October 2022 – January 2023:
Upgraded frontend code from React 15.6 to React 18.2 to enhance security and integration with third-party libraries; this required a routing rewrite to fit the new structure and enabled modern features to speed up loading. September 2021 – October 2021:
Consulted with engineering staff to evaluate interface between hardware and software, develop specifications and performance requirements, or resolve customer problems. Technologies & Roles
Tech stack: TypeScript, React.JS, Redux, WebSocket, getStream.io, Adobe XD, Chakra UI Roles: Front End Engineering; Quality Assurance Software at Talentsky
#J-18808-Ljbffr